How to grow sprouted garlic
Overview
In winter, especially after the heating is turned on, some garlic has sprouted. Because the sprouted garlic cloves have given nutrients to new life, they will inevitably shrink and wither, and their edible value will be greatly reduced. Therefore, if you find that garlic has sprouted, you might as well just cultivate it and eat the young garlic sprouts. Not only are the garlic sprouts delicious, but the garlic will not be wasted.

Steps
-
Prepare garlic, orange peel, needle and thread.
-
Prepare a small bowl, chop the orange peel and put it in the water.
-
Peel the garlic you need and string the garlic from the root with a string of about 10 cm.
-
Just one bunch and it's ready.
-
All skewered.
-
water and put it 1/3 of the way up the root of the garlic.
-
This is the garlic sprout that grew the next day.
-
Roots sprouted in two days.
-
This is the garlic sprout that grew on the fourth day.
-
This is the garlic sprout that grew on the sixth day.
-
Garlic seedlings of 20 cm will grow in six days.
-
After six days, it can be cut and eaten.
-
The cut garlic sprouts can be mixed with the sauce.
